Compiling and Flashing

Make example for this keyboard (after setting up your build environment):

make idobao/id42:default

Flashing example for this keyboard:

make idobao/id42:default:flash

See the build environment setup and the make instructions for more information.

Bootloader

Enter the bootloader in 3 ways:

  • Bootmagic reset: Hold down the [Esc] key and plug in the keyboard
  • Physical reset button: Briefly press the button on the back of the PCB
  • Keycode in layout: Press the key mapped to RESET (Default = [Fn]+[R]) if it is available
